Gutter waterproofing services involve the installation or enhancement of gutter systems to prevent water from infiltrating the structure of a property. These services typically include sealing leaks, adding protective coatings, and installing gutter guards or covers that ensure water flows efficiently away from the building. Proper waterproofing helps maintain the integrity of the gutters and prevents water from seeping into walls, foundations, or basements, which can lead to costly repairs over time. Local service providers assess existing gutter systems and recommend solutions tailored to the specific needs of each property to ensure optimal water management.
One of the primary issues gutter waterproofing addresses is water damage caused by overflowing or leaking gutters. When gutters are not properly sealed or protected, water can spill over and accumulate around the foundation, leading to erosion, basement flooding, or structural deterioration. Additionally, water that seeps into walls or roofing areas can promote mold growth and compromise the building's interior. Gutter waterproofing services help mitigate these risks by ensuring that water is directed away from vulnerable areas, reducing the potential for long-term damage and maintaining the property's overall stability.

Material and Surface Preparation - Costs for preparing gutters and surrounding areas typically range from $150 to $400. This includes cleaning, debris removal, and minor repairs to ensure proper waterproofing. Variations depend on gutter condition and property size.
Sealant Application - Applying waterproof sealants usually costs between $200 and $600. The price varies based on the length of gutters and the complexity of the sealing process needed to prevent leaks.
Gutter Lining Installation - Installing waterproof lining systems can range from $1,000 to $3,000. Larger or multi-story properties tend to have higher costs due to increased labor and material requirements.
Additional Repairs or Upgrades - Costs for extra repairs, such as replacing sections of gutters or adding protective covers, typically fall between $300 and $1,200. The final price depends on the extent of the work needed and local contractor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is gutter waterproofing? Gutter waterproofing involves applying protective materials to gutters to prevent water leaks and damage, ensuring proper water flow away from the property.
Why should I consider gutter waterproofing services? Gutter waterproofing can help protect your home's foundation, walls, and landscaping from water damage caused by leaks or overflows.
How do local pros typically waterproof gutters? Professionals may use sealants, waterproof coatings, or gutter liners to enhance the water resistance of existing gutters and prevent leaks.
Are gutter waterproofing services suitable for all types of gutters? Most gutter types can benefit from waterproofing, but a local contractor can assess your specific system to recommend the best solution.
